Set Realistic Goals
It is always best to start with small, realistic goals when beginning any type of weight loss plan. This way, you are more likely to stick with the plan and see results.

Losing even a small amount of weight can have major health benefits. Try setting a goal to lose a percentage of your current body weight. For example, if you weigh 250 pounds, your goal would be to lose 20-25 pounds.
Find a Way to Stay Motivated
There are a few ways to stay motivated throughout your weight loss journey. One way is to set small goals for yourself and celebrate when you reach them.
Another way is to find a workout buddy or group to help keep you accountable. It can also be helpful to keep a journal to document your progress and reflect on your successes. Finally, don’t be too hard on yourself if you have a bad day or week, just get back on track and keep moving forward.
Make Adjustments for Success
Be sure to make adjustments to your diet and exercise routine as needed. If something isn’t working, don’t be afraid to change it up. This may mean changing the time of day that you exercise, the types of foods that you eat, or the amount of time that you spend preparing meals.
It is also important to find a balance between challenging yourself and not overdoing it. Beginners should start slowly and gradually increase the difficulty of their workouts and the intensity of their calorie restriction. By making these small changes, you will be more likely to stick to your weight loss plan and see results.
